We’re getting close to the end of 2011, and as usual I’m behind on new releases that have crossed my path this year.

Like the new Sons And Daughters album, which I’ve been listening to for the past few months, and have been digging a lot.

I’ve been impressed with S&D since their Johnny Cash EP, and this is the first time I’ve gone in with trepidation. The new album is pretty experimental sound-wise, with more mood, open spaces and noise compared to their previous stuff (which can be described as either angry folk-punk or angry indie-pop), and it took a little letting used to. But the second listen won me over and it’s probably going to make my Top Ten for the year.
